MNJ Technologies Ranked 15th ‘Best Place to Work in Illinois’

Latest Accolade for Rapidly Growing Solution Provider

BUFFALO GROVE, IL (August 14th, 2020)

MNJ Technologies, a midmarket-focused IT solution and managed services provider, today announced that it has been named as the 15th Best Place to Work in Illinois among medium size companies. It is one of only 19 companies recognized in the program’s 100-to-499-employee category this year, based on an analysis of nominees’ workplace policies, practices and demographics as well as an employee work experience survey.

The statewide competition is sponsored by The Daily Herald Business Ledger in partnership with the Illinois Chamber of Commerce, MRA-The Management Association, the Small Business Advocacy Council and Best Companies Group.

The accolade is the latest in a series received by MNJ since January, including recognition on the CRN 2020 MSP Elite 150 and CRN Tech Elite 250 lists, advancement to Platinum Level status in the Dell Technologies Partner Program, and achievement of the new Cisco CX Specialization designation for maximizing customer satisfaction. These honors stemmed in part from MNJ’s rapid growth, including a 23% overall revenue increase in 2019 that far outpaced other companies in the space.

“We have spent the last three years in an extensive company makeover that has included a heavy emphasis on corporate culture. Initiatives have ranged from running improvisation workshops to help our employees think creatively to overhauling our commission and health insurance plans, establishing quarterly coffee talks and mentoring programs, and adding paid time off for community service or volunteer activities,” said MNJ President Susan Kozak. “These efforts have not only led directly to our Best Places to Work in Illinois honors but also have been instrumental in driving company growth.”

The final rankings were announced at an August 20 awards ceremony, posted on the Business Ledger website, and will be published in September issue of the Daily Herald Business Ledger on September 21st .
